In a notable achievement, Mundy Cruising has once again secured its Investors in People accreditation with results that have been described as “better than ever.” This distinguished status is a testament to the luxury and expedition cruise agency’s commitment to excellence across various operational facets. The accreditation process thoroughly evaluated the company, lauding its leadership capabilities, the empowering environment it fosters, and its continuous improvement strategies, which have all contributed to Mundy’s sustainable success.
Managing Director Edwina Lonsdale emphasised the significance of the accreditation, especially in the evolving post-pandemic business landscape. She stated, “We have worked with Investors in People for over 15 years and the accreditation really matters to us as it offers a truly independent and officially-recognised certification of workplace excellence.” This sentiment resonates with the company’s transformative journey and dedication to maintaining high standards.
Significant growth has been reported within Mundy Cruising’s sales, marketing, and operations sectors. Alex Loizou, the Sales Marketing and Operations Director, attributed this success to the company’s thriving culture and the robust trust between the team and its clients. He remarked, “We are enjoying triple-figure growth this year, and clearly much of that is going to be down to our culture, our team and the relationships of trust they build with our discerning clientele.” Such acknowledgments accentuate the pivotal role of team dynamics in Mundy’s business achievements.
Paul Devoy, the Chief Executive of Investors in People, congratulated Mundy Cruising on their exceptional accomplishment. He highlighted the prestige associated with the “We invest in people” accreditation, reinforcing its value by stating that it aligns Mundy with other elite organisations that recognise the importance of investing in their workforce.
